Hello community, here is the log from the commit of package libjnidispatch for openSUSE:Factory checked in at 2015-11-10 10:03:39 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/libjnidispatch (Old) and /work/SRC/openSUSE:Factory/.libjnidispatch.new (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"libjnidispatch" Changes: -------- --- /work/SRC/openSUSE:Factory/libjnidispatch/libjnidispatch.changes 2015-04-02 15:57:58.000000000 +0200 +++ /work/SRC/openSUSE:Factory/.libjnidispatch.new/libjnidispatch.changes 2015-11-10 10:03:51.000000000 +0100 @@ -1,0 +2,14 @@ +Sun Nov 8 23:31:55 UTC 2015 - p.drou...@gmail.com + +- Update to version 4.2.1 + * Add support for linux-sparcv9. + * Added `GetCommState`, `GetCommTimeouts` `SetCommState` and `SetCommTimeouts` + to `com.sun.jna.platform.win32.Kernel32`. Added `DCB` structure to + `com.sun.jna.platform.win32.WinBase. + * Make loading debug flags mutable. + * Added `host_processor_info` to `com.sun.jna.platform.mac.SystemB`. + * Added JNA functional overview. + * Update linux-arm natives omitted in 4.2. +- Update jna-4.1.0-build.patch > jna-build.patch + +------------------------------------------------------------------- Old: ---- 4.1.0.tar.gz jna-4.1.0-build.patch New: ---- 4.2.1.tar.gz jna-build.patch 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 libjnidispatch.spec ++++++ --- /var/tmp/diff_new_pack.OZwOdU/_old 2015-11-10 10:03:54.000000000 +0100 +++ /var/tmp/diff_new_pack.OZwOdU/_new 2015-11-10 10:03:54.000000000 +0100 @@ -18,16 +18,16 @@ Name: libjnidispatch -Version: 4.1.0 +Version: 4.2.1 Release: 0 Summary: Java Native Access (shared library) License: LGPL-2.1+ or Apache-2.0 Group: Development/Libraries/Java Url: https://github.com/twall/jna Source0: https://github.com/twall/jna/archive/%{version}.tar.gz -Source1: jna-%{version}.pom +Source1: jna-4.1.0.pom Source2: libjnidispatch-rpmlintrc -Patch0: jna-%{version}-build.patch +Patch0: jna-build.patch BuildRequires: ant BuildRequires: ant-junit BuildRequires: dos2unix ++++++ 4.1.0.tar.gz -> 4.2.1.tar.gz ++++++ /work/SRC/openSUSE:Factory/libjnidispatch/4.1.0.tar.gz /work/SRC/openSUSE:Factory/.libjnidispatch.new/4.2.1.tar.gz differ: char 13, line 1 ++++++ jna-4.1.0-build.patch -> jna-build.patch ++++++ --- /work/SRC/openSUSE:Factory/libjnidispatch/jna-4.1.0-build.patch 2014-11-12 00:21:50.000000000 +0100 +++ /work/SRC/openSUSE:Factory/.libjnidispatch.new/jna-build.patch 2015-11-10 10:03:51.000000000 +0100 @@ -20,7 +20,7 @@ description="Build primary jar"> <!-- Bundle native components with primary jar to facilitate easy distribution to common platforms. -@@ -364,118 +364,10 @@ +@@ -379,137 +379,10 @@ <!-- Note that no terminal "*" is included in this list, which will force failure on unsupported platforms. --> @@ -30,6 +30,10 @@ -processor=x86;osname=win32, -com/sun/jna/win32-x86-64/jnidispatch.dll; -processor=x86-64;osname=win32, +-com/sun/jna/win32-x86/jnidispatch.dll; +-processor=x86;osname=win, +-com/sun/jna/win32-x86-64/jnidispatch.dll; +-processor=x86-64;osname=win, -com/sun/jna/w32ce-arm/jnidispatch.dll; -processor=arm;osname=wince, - @@ -51,14 +55,20 @@ -processor=ppc;osname=linux, -com/sun/jna/linux-ppc64/libjnidispatch.so; -processor=ppc64;osname=linux, +-com/sun/jna/linux-ppc64le/libjnidispatch.so; +-processor=ppc64le;osname=linux, -com/sun/jna/linux-x86/libjnidispatch.so; -processor=x86;osname=linux, -com/sun/jna/linux-x86-64/libjnidispatch.so; -processor=x86-64;osname=linux, -com/sun/jna/linux-arm/libjnidispatch.so; -processor=arm;osname=linux, +-com/sun/jna/linux-aarch64/libjnidispatch.so; +-processor=aarch64;osname=linux, -com/sun/jna/linux-ia64/libjnidispatch.so; -processor=ia64;osname=linux, +-com/sun/jna/linux-sparcv9/libjnidispatch.so; +-processor=sparcv9;osname=linux, - -com/sun/jna/freebsd-x86/libjnidispatch.so; -processor=x86;osname=freebsd, @@ -97,6 +107,9 @@ - <zipfileset src="${lib.native}/linux-arm.jar" - includes="*jnidispatch*" - prefix="com/sun/jna/linux-arm"/> +- <zipfileset src="${lib.native}/linux-aarch64.jar" +- includes="*jnidispatch*" +- prefix="com/sun/jna/linux-aarch64"/> - <zipfileset src="${lib.native}/linux-ia64.jar" - includes="*jnidispatch*" - prefix="com/sun/jna/linux-ia64"/> @@ -106,6 +119,12 @@ - <zipfileset src="${lib.native}/linux-ppc64.jar" - includes="*jnidispatch*" - prefix="com/sun/jna/linux-ppc64"/> +- <zipfileset src="${lib.native}/linux-ppc64le.jar" +- includes="*jnidispatch*" +- prefix="com/sun/jna/linux-ppc64le"/> +- <zipfileset src="${lib.native}/linux-sparcv9.jar" +- includes="*jnidispatch*" +- prefix="com/sun/jna/linux-sparcv9"/> - <zipfileset src="${lib.native}/sunos-x86.jar" - includes="*jnidispatch*" - prefix="com/sun/jna/sunos-x86"/> @@ -179,7 +198,7 @@ # Default to Sun recommendations for JNI compilation COPT=-O2 -fno-omit-frame-pointer -fno-strict-aliasing CASM=-S -@@ -105,7 +105,7 @@ endif +@@ -108,7 +108,7 @@ # Avoid bug in X11-based 1.5/1.6 VMs; dynamically load instead of linking # See http://bugs.sun.com/bugdatabase/view_bug.do?bug_id=6539705 #LIBS=-L"$(LIBDIR)" -ljawt @@ -187,4 +206,4 @@ +STRIP=@echo # end defaults - # Android build (cross-compile) requires the android SDK+NDK. + # Android build (cross-compile) requires the android NDK.